ZANETTI: "VITAL WIN, NOW WE NEED CONSISTENCY"

Javier Zanetti on BeIN Sports 1’s Le club du Dimanche: "We’re all working together to build something great at Inter"

MILAN – Inter vice president Javier Zanetti sat down for a tell-all interview with BeIN Sports 1’s Le club du Dimanche to speak all things Nerazzurri this evening.

"I remember that we were on the Terrazza Martini and it was pouring with rain. Giacinto Facchetti was there – an Inter legend – as well as Sebastian Rambert, who was the leading scorer in the Argentine league. He was the big star of course, then everyone knows the career I went on to have at the club," recalls Zanetti of his first day at Inter.

"The best moment of my career was undoubtedly the Champions League final against Bayern. It was a dream night in a wonderful stadium and I had the privilege of captaining the side. On top of everything, it was Inter’s first final in forty years. I’ll never forget the fans’ joy and the celebrations the day after," smiled the Argentine.

There was also a word on the current Nerazzurri crop’s convincing 1-4 win at Atalanta this afternoon: "It was a vital win today especially after we got the three points at Palermo. Slowly but surely, we’re getting closer to the European places and that’s our goal. We’re trying to find some consistency.

"Thohir’s project, his ideas… they’re fascinating. And the Moratti family is right there beside him. We’re all working together to build something great at Inter. We’re doing all we can to ensure Inter triumph in Europe once again," said Zanetti.
